What does Google say about SEO? /
This category compiles all official Google statements regarding JavaScript and technical aspects of search engine optimization. Modern JavaScript frameworks (React, Angular, Vue.js) and web application architectures (SPA, SSR, CSR) present critical challenges for crawling and indexing. Google's guidance on JavaScript rendering, dynamic DOM manipulation, AJAX implementation, and API calls is essential for ensuring client-side content visibility. SEO professionals will find authoritative positions on implementation best practices, differences between server-side and client-side rendering, and recommendations for optimizing load times while guaranteeing content accessibility to search crawlers. Understanding data formats (JSON, XML) and their SEO implications completes this vital resource. These official declarations help prevent common technical implementation mistakes that can severely impact the search performance of modern websites and JavaScript-powered applications. Access to Google's verified positions on these technical matters enables practitioners to make informed architectural decisions and implement JavaScript solutions that maintain strong organic search visibility while delivering enhanced user experiences.
Quick SEO Quiz

Test your SEO knowledge in 5 questions

Less than a minute. Find out how much you really know about Google search.

🕒 ~1 min 🎯 5 questions
★★ Should you duplicate your content across multiple geographic domains?
If the content is not specifically geographically relevant, it is generally better to keep it on a single domain, even if it is in multiple languages, to avoid unnecessary complications....
John Mueller Mar 20, 2020
★★ Can you really submit a manual review request immediately after fixing an issue?
There is no minimum waiting period required between fixing an issue and submitting a review request. If the issue is resolved quickly, a request can be submitted immediately....
John Mueller Mar 20, 2020
★★★ Does loading speed really hinder Google crawling and ranking?
Loading speed influences the number of pages that Google can crawl. A slow speed can limit crawling, while a fast loading time is crucial for ranking based on user experience....
John Mueller Mar 20, 2020
★★★ Does the Search Console Index Coverage Report really help diagnose your indexing issues?
The Index Coverage Report in Google Search Console provides an overview of all the pages that Google has indexed or attempted to index on your website....
Daniel Waisberg Mar 19, 2020
★★★ Is page load speed really a crucial ranking factor?
Historically, only very slow sites were affected by page load speed in terms of SEO ranking. Google may consider a more nuanced approach, but for moderately fast sites, there is no significant differe...
John Mueller Mar 17, 2020
★★★ Should You Really Block Internal Search Results Pages from Indexing?
John Mueller explained on Twitter that it was important not to index internal search engine results pages. Not for spam reasons, but because it can generate an infinite number of pages and drown quali...
John Mueller Mar 16, 2020
★★★ Is post-prerendering JavaScript really safe for SEO?
After the prerendering of a page, it is perfectly acceptable to use JavaScript to improve interactivity or add dynamic elements. It does not negatively affect SEO as long as the main content remains a...
John Mueller Mar 16, 2020
★★ Should you really prioritize SSR and prerendering to enhance your crawl efficiency?
Prerendering and server-side rendering are useful techniques as they allow quick access to content for users and bots, thus reducing the long-term need for dynamic rendering....
Martin Splitt Mar 16, 2020
★★★ Should you really prerender 100% of your content for Googlebot to index it properly?
When prerendering your pages, include as much content as possible, even if Googlebot doesn't generate elements via JavaScript; this ensures it accesses a complete version during crawling....
John Mueller Mar 16, 2020
★★★ What happens when JavaScript rewrites your title tags and jeopardizes your Google indexing?
If a site has titles altered by a JavaScript chat feature, Google could index these rewritten versions. One possible solution is to delay the appearance of the chat until user interaction, as Googlebo...
Martin Splitt Mar 16, 2020
★★★ Should you really be cautious about JavaScript in prerendered content?
It is perfectly acceptable to use JavaScript to add interactive elements to prerendered content. This can improve the user experience without harming SEO....
John Mueller Mar 16, 2020
★★★ Is dynamic rendering really on its way out in SEO?
Server-side rendering and prerendering are unlikely to disappear, as they enable the rapid delivery of HTML content to users and crawlers. Dynamic rendering is temporary and may be abandoned in the lo...
Martin Splitt Mar 16, 2020
★★★ Does JavaScript prerendering still pose indexing risks for SEO?
During prerendering, it is crucial to include as much content as possible to ensure Googlebot has access to all information. This typically means not ignoring elements generated by JavaScript....
John Mueller Mar 16, 2020
★★★ Should you block title modifications via JavaScript to prevent unwanted indexing?
If a chat modifies the page title via JavaScript, it is advised to position the chat behind a user interaction to prevent Google from indexing the modified version of the title....
Martin Splitt Mar 16, 2020
★★★ Do You Really Need an XML Sitemap to Improve Your SEO Rankings?
In a video on the YouTube channel for webmasters dedicated to XML Sitemaps, Googler Daniel Waisberg explains that these files are primarily interesting in 3 or 4 cases: if the site is very large, if c...
Google Mar 09, 2020
★★★ How long should you really keep a redirect after a domain migration?
Keep redirects from old domains for at least a year after migration to properly pass authority, and ideally, for as long as possible to prevent spam issues on old domain names....
John Mueller Mar 06, 2020
★★ Does a duplicated H1 across multiple pages really harm SEO?
While using the same H1 across multiple pages isn't ideal, it probably won't affect the site's visibility in search results. However, it's advisable to adapt the model if possible, whenever changes ar...
John Mueller Mar 06, 2020
★★★ Are XML sitemaps really essential for Google's crawling?
A sitemap can help Google discover and prioritize the pages of your site, especially if your site is very large, contains isolated pages, or if its content changes rapidly, like news sites....
Google Mar 04, 2020
★★★ Is PageRank Still a Decisive Ranking Factor in SEO?
John Mueller explained on Twitter that Google's algorithm still uses the concept of PageRank today, even though the current PR has changed significantly from the initial formula: "It's not quite the s...
John Mueller Mar 02, 2020
★★★ Does Googlebot really execute all your JavaScript, or is it just bluffing?
Googlebot executes JavaScript to index the final content rendered by it. However, if the analysis shows that the rendering of JavaScript does not lead to major changes, Googlebot may process the page ...
John Mueller Feb 21, 2020
🔔

Get real-time analysis of the latest Google SEO declarations

Be the first to know every time a new official Google statement drops — with full expert analysis.

No spam. Unsubscribe in one click.